Output d8aa48cc73e74ef7af766ca1da295eb78afa68bcfd3a58cdbbf409d7b2aabb2c:3

value
1002385
script pubkey
OP_0 OP_PUSHBYTES_20 e43e127676e71a2fde02d4e606f7d000294cb92b
address
bc1quslpyankuudzlhsz6nnqda7sqq55ewftaj8z3w
transaction
d8aa48cc73e74ef7af766ca1da295eb78afa68bcfd3a58cdbbf409d7b2aabb2c
confirmations
33716
spent
false